About SASRIA
SASRIA is a state-owned entity established in 1979 to provide special risk insurance in South Africa. It offers coverage for perils such as civil commotion, public disorder, strikes, and terrorism that are typically excluded from traditional insurance policies. SASRIA’s main mandate is to offer comprehensive insurance products to individuals, businesses, and organizations that operate in the public and private sectors, helping them mitigate the financial risks posed by such events.
SASRIA plays a vital role in ensuring that businesses and individuals are protected from the significant losses that can arise from unrest or similar risks. With its deep understanding of the unique challenges facing the South African market, SASRIA is committed to innovation, customer service, and sound financial management. Internship Roles and Responsibilities
The SASRIA Graduate Internship Programme 2025 provides interns with the opportunity to work in several key areas of the company, depending on their academic background and interests. Some of the possible roles and responsibilities include:
1. Risk Management Intern
As a risk management intern, you will assist the risk assessment team in identifying, evaluating, and mitigating the risks that SASRIA covers. You will learn how to analyze historical data, assess emerging risks, and participate in developing risk mitigation strategies. This role is ideal for graduates in fields such as Risk Management, Actuarial Science, Finance, or Mathematics.
2. Underwriting Intern
Interns in the underwriting department will support the team in evaluating and processing insurance applications. This may include assessing the risk profile of applicants, calculating premiums, and assisting in policy development. This role is perfect for graduates in Insurance, Finance, or Actuarial Science.
3. Claims Management Intern
Claims management interns will work closely with the claims team to process claims made by customers. This involves investigating claims, ensuring that they meet the necessary criteria, and assisting in the claims settlement process. Interns may also be involved in communicating with policyholders and resolving any issues related to claims. Ideal candidates for this role would have a background in Insurance, Law, or Business Administration.
4. Financial Management Intern
As a financial management intern, you will gain experience in the financial operations of a public-sector insurer. Responsibilities may include assisting with budgeting, financial reporting, and analysis, as well as supporting audits and compliance checks. This role is suitable for graduates with a background in Finance, Accounting, or Economics.
5. Customer Service Intern
Interns in customer service will help manage client relationships and ensure that customers receive the support they need. You may be involved in responding to inquiries, resolving complaints, and assisting with policy renewals. Strong communication and problem-solving skills are essential for this role. Graduates in Business Administration, Marketing, or Communications are ideal candidates.
6. Human Resources Intern
If you’re interested in human resources, this internship provides exposure to recruitment, employee relations, and training programs. You will assist in various HR functions, from onboarding new employees to assisting with performance evaluations. Ideal for graduates in Human Resources, Industrial Psychology, or Business Administration.
Eligibility Criteria
To be eligible for the SASRIA Graduate Internship Programme 2025, applicants must meet the following criteria:
- Educational Requirements: You should hold a degree or diploma in one of the following fields (or a related field):
- Risk Management
- Insurance
- Finance
- Actuarial Science
- Business Administration
- Law
- Economics
- Marketing
- Human Resources
- Communications
- Experience: The internship is open to recent graduates or final-year students with limited or no professional experience.
- Skills: Strong analytical, communication, and problem-solving skills are essential. Candidates should be able to work in a team and exhibit initiative and a strong work ethic.
- Other Requirements: Applicants should be willing to work in Johannesburg or other designated locations. A valid driver’s license may be required for certain positions.
